About Panama
Panama, a vibrant country located at the crossroads of Central and South America, is renowned for its iconic Panama Canal, a marvel of engineering that connects the Atlantic and Pacific Oceans. This narrow isthmus is bordered by Costa Rica to the west and Colombia to the east, with the Caribbean Sea to the north and the Pacific Ocean to the south. Panama boasts a rich cultural heritage, blending indigenous traditions with Spanish colonial influences, and is home to a diverse population. Its capital, Panama City, is a bustling metropolis known for its modern skyline, historic Casco Viejo district, and vibrant nightlife. The country is also celebrated for its stunning natural beauty, including lush rainforests, pristine beaches, and abundant wildlife, making it a haven for eco-tourism and adventure seekers. With a stable economy driven by the canal, banking, and tourism, Panama continues to thrive as a dynamic and welcoming nation.
